Transparency International Ukraine has completed its third study of transparency of 100 largest Ukrainian cities as part of the Transparent Cities program

For the past two months, the team of the “Transparent Cities” project has been verifying the websites of 100 city councils, analyzing their responses to public requests and compiling the long-awaited ranking. And now we are ready to share its results with you.
